About this book

"Over Periscope Pond" by Esther Sayles Root and Marjorie Crocker is a collection of letters written by two American girls in Paris during World War I, specifically from October 1916 to January 1918. Through their correspondence, Root and Crocker recount their experiences and adventures as they engage in relief work, providing insights into the lives of refugees and the impact of the war on daily life. Their narrative embodies the spirit of youthful determination and resilience amidst challenging times. At the start of the narrative, Esther Sayles Root writes to her father from aboard the ship Espagne, recounting her journey to Paris filled with excitement and trepidation. From the moment they set sail, her vivid descriptions capture the beauty of the voyage, her interactions with fellow passengers, and the underlying anxiety surrounding the threat of submarines. Upon arriving in Bordeaux and eventually reaching Paris, Esther is struck by the vibrancy of the city, detailing her initial disorientation as she navigates its streets and customs. Through her letters, she introduces readers to the warmth and challenges of life in wartime France, setting the stage for the touching stories of resilience and humanity that will unfold in the subsequent passages.
